Write a rule for the nth term of the geometric sequence using the given information: a1= 5 and r=2

Answer:


\huge A (n) = 5 ({2})^(n - 1) \\

Explanation:

The nth term of a geometric sequence is given by


A(n) = a _ 1( {r})^(n - 1)

a1 is the first term

r is the common ratio

From the question we have the final answer as


A (n) = 5 ({2})^(n - 1)
